Poly microfiber is made from synthetic fibers, primarily polyester and polyamide (nylon). These fibers are woven together to create a dense, soft material known for its durability, absorbency, and lightweight properties. Poly microfiber is commonly used in cleaning cloths, upholstery, and athletic wear due to its ability to effectively trap dirt and moisture while remaining gentle on surfaces.

Are olefin and microfiber the same thing?

Both olefin and microfiber are synthetic fibers, though they are made from different processes. Olefin is made using ethylene or propylene. Microfiber is made by combining thin strands of polyester and nylon.


What is microfiber made of?

Microfiber is typically made of polyester, polyamide, or a blend of both. These synthetic fibers are finely woven to create a fabric that is soft, durable, and highly absorbent.

What is a microfiber towel made of and how does it differ from traditional towels in terms of material composition?

A microfiber towel is made of synthetic fibers like polyester and nylon, which are much finer than those in traditional towels. This allows microfiber towels to be more absorbent, quick-drying, and softer than traditional towels made of cotton or other natural fibers.


What is microfiber dust mop?

A microfiber dust mop typically consists of a long handle for reaching high places, with a removable microfiber cloth pad attached to the base. Microfiber mops are used dry for dusting ceiling corners, floor and trim, and wet for washing and shining floors made of wood, tile and other hard materials. Microfiber, made from polyester and polyamide fibers, is excellent for cleaning a wide variety of items and surfaces, from jewelry to floors and cars to light fixtures.


Is microfiber is natural?

Microfiber is not a natural material; it is a synthetic fiber made from polyester and nylon. These fibers are derived from petrochemicals, making them man-made rather than sourced from natural materials like cotton or wool. Microfiber is known for its softness, durability, and ability to trap dirt and moisture, which is why it is popular for cleaning and textile applications.

Does microfiber stretch?

Microfiber generally does not stretch significantly, as it is made from tightly woven synthetic fibers, which maintain their shape and structure. However, certain microfiber fabrics blended with elastic materials may exhibit some degree of stretch. Overall, while microfiber is durable and flexible to an extent, it is not known for its stretchability like spandex or similar fabrics.
